What is RDP?


Redispersible Polymer Powder (RDP) is a powdered polymer that can be redispersed in water to form a stable emulsion. It is produced through a spray-drying process, where polymer emulsions are dried into a fine powder. When mixed with other components, such as cement and fine aggregates, RDP contributes to improved workability, adhesion, and flexibility of the final adhesive formulation. RDP is typically derived from various types of polymers, such as acrylates and vinyl acetate-ethylene copolymers, each imparting unique properties to the adhesive.


Benefits of RDP in Ceramic Tile Adhesives


1. Enhanced Adhesion One of the primary advantages of incorporating RDP into ceramic tile adhesives is its ability to enhance adhesion to a variety of substrates. The polymer powder improves the bond strength between the tile and the substrate, reducing the risk of tile failure or detachment over time. This is especially crucial in areas subjected to movement or temperature fluctuations.


2. Improved Flexibility and Workability RDP-modified adhesives offer greater flexibility, which is essential for accommodating thermal expansion and contraction. This flexibility helps prevent cracking and other forms of damage, particularly in environments where temperature changes are frequent. Moreover, RDP enhances the workability of the adhesive, allowing for easier application and better positioning of tiles during installation.


3. Water Resistance Another significant benefit of RDP is its contribution to the water resistance of tile adhesives. When tiles are installed in wet areas, such as bathrooms or kitchens, the adhesive must withstand moisture without degrading. RDP enhances the water-resistant properties of the adhesive, ensuring that the bond remains intact even in humid conditions.

4. Improved Open Time RDP can also extend the open time of tile adhesives, providing installers with more flexibility during the application process. This is particularly beneficial in larger projects where precise adjustments may be necessary before the adhesive sets.


5. Low VOC Emissions As environmental concerns continue to rise, the demand for low VOC (volatile organic compounds) products is increasing. RDP applications typically involve lower emissions, making RDP-modified adhesives a more environmentally friendly choice.


Applications of RDP-modified Adhesives


RDP-modified ceramic tile adhesives are suitable for a wide range of applications. They can be used for various types of ceramic tiles, including porcelain, mosaics, and natural stone. These adhesives are ideal for both interior and exterior installations, making them versatile for residential and commercial projects.


Furthermore, RDP can be utilized in specialized contexts, such as underfloor heating systems, where the adhesive must maintain its integrity under varying temperature conditions. It is also effective for installing tiles in high-traffic areas, ensuring longevity and durability.
